French President Emmanuel Macron is signalling a hardening of his position on Israel in the war in Gaza as officials increasingly criticise the high death toll after an initial period of support for its military response to the October 7 attacks. Mr Macron blamed Israel for the death of 112 Palestinians last week after Israeli forces opened fire on a crowd gathered around an aid convoy in northern Gaza.
